I was also thinking about my experiences learning new languages, such as
German and Arabic. After a while in immersion, the group developed a way
of speaking the new learned language that the teacher would not
understand. Between us, though, all seemed perfect (grammar and
pronounciation). We were even correcting each other. I am wondering if
it is not the case here with this post. After all, we have a teacher but
he is not there all the time. We also have excellent students who speak
and write certainly more fluently than many of us (especially me).
